Unlike plant cells, which have inflexible cell walls and have chloroplasts for photosynthesis, animal cells are characterized by their adaptable plasma membranes that enable for an extra dynamic array of functions. Labeled animal cell representations often highlight the center plainly, illustrating its double-membrane framework, the nucleolus within it, and chromatin product that condenses to develop chromosomes throughout cell division.

Mitochondria, commonly called the "powerhouses" of the cell, are liable for energy manufacturing via the process of mobile respiration. In even more comprehensive animal cell layouts, mitochondria are shown with their inner and external membranes as well as their own collection of DNA, showing their unique evolutionary background as once-independent microorganisms.

Ribosomes, the cellular equipment responsible for healthy protein synthesis, can either drift easily in the cytoplasm or be connected to the endoplasmic reticulum (EMERGENCY ROOM). The ER is additional split right into harsh and smooth types; the harsh emergency room, studded with ribosomes, plays a critical role in synthesizing healthy proteins predestined for export or for usage in the cell membrane, while the smooth ER is involved in lipid synthesis and cleansing procedures. Another important element of animal cells is the Golgi device, which refines, types, and distributes proteins and lipids manufactured in the emergency room. This organelle can be envisioned in an animal cell diagram as a collection of piled, membrane-bound sacs. The Golgi apparatus functions similar to a delivery and getting division, making sure that healthy proteins are appropriately changed and dispatched to their intended locations, whether inside or outside the cell. The elaborate workings of the Golgi show the level of organization and teamwork needed for cell feature.

Lysosomes, the cell's waste disposal system, contain digestive enzymes designed to damage down macromolecules, mobile particles, and foreign invaders. They can be seen in labeled animal cell diagrams as tiny, round blisters throughout the cytoplasm. The value of lysosomes is starkly highlighted in research study concerning neurodegenerative diseases, where a breakdown in these organelles can bring about the build-up of harmful materials within cells, contributing to mobile aging and fatality.

Along with lysosomes, another important collection of organelles is peroxisomes, which are associated with metabolic processes, including the failure of hydrogen peroxide, a possibly damaging by-product of cellular metabolic rate.
